Output 68d0865282cf08758facbfefefd2ace107b3fba43d8b38adc877ec7980520394:161

value
215300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2fde574b11e97cbb98f4e463380132fa6960a1 OP_EQUAL
address
3HJApJvQunpwWYoB187V4BF2H17yvaShLS
transaction
68d0865282cf08758facbfefefd2ace107b3fba43d8b38adc877ec7980520394
confirmations
236625
spent
true